2015-16 Women's Basketball

20 Morgan McDonald

  • Height 5-6
  • Class Senior
  • Highschool Carrollton
  • Hometown Carrollton, Ga.

Biography

Also plays on Panthers' women's tennis team...

2015-16 (Basketball): Played in 25 games with one start... Averaged 1.9 points per game... Had season-high six points at Agnes Scott on Dec. 2 and again on Jan. 17 against Mary Baldwin... Had season-high four assists against Toccoa Falls on Nov. 17...

2015 (Tennis): Second team USA South All-Conference... Earned USA South Academic All-Conference honors... Went 11-1 at #1 singles, including 9-1 mark in USA South play... Has overall career mark of 31-9... Had 8-4 record in doubles with Ali Herring, including 7-4 at #2 doubles and 1-0 at #1 doubles...

2014-15 (Basketball): Played in 26 games with 23 starts... Averaged 5.8 points per game... Led team in 3-point shots made (23) and attempted (78)... Second on the team with 55 assists... Second on team with 77.6 free throw percentage... Had career-high 17 points against Greensboro on Jan. 4... In same game, made career-high four 3-pointers... Had career-high six assists against Oglethorpe on Nov. 30 and Methodist on Jan. 3... 

2014 (Tennis): Received team's Coaches Award... Team representative on USA South All-Sportsmanship team... Had team best records of 11-3 overall and 9-2 in USA South matches... 10-3 at #3 singles and 1-0 at #4 singles... Had 8-5 record with Caroline Brashier at #1 doubles... Had second-best winning percentage (.769) in conference at #3 singles... Won first nine matches of the season, eight in straight sets...

2013-14 (Basketball): Played in all 27 games... Averaged 4.0 points per game... Had season and career high 13 points against William Peace on Jan. 25... Had season-high four assists three times during season... Had season-high three steals at Mississippi College on Nov. 22...

2013 (Tennis): Team's representative on USA South All-Sportsmanship team... Received team's Coaches Award... Had team-best record of 9-5, all at #5 singles... Also had team-best conference record at 7-4... Had overall record of 7-7 at #3 doubles with Blake Alford and Madison McDonald (no relation)... Rallied to win in three sets in deciding match against North Carolina Wesleyan on March 17... Had team-best streak of six straight wins in singles that included three matches without dropping a game...

2012-13 (Basketball): Played in 20 games... Averaged 0.9 points per game... Had season-highs of 15 minutes played, nine points against Mary Baldwin on Jan. 20... Also went 4-for-4 from the free throw line and had three assists in same game...

High School: As a senior; Whitley Morris Fieldhouse and Charlie Grisham Scholarships recipient... School's Most Athletic Female... Outstanding Senior... Trojan Award for basketball and soccer... Wendy's Heisman recipient... As a junior; Academic Award for basketball... As a sophomore; Academic Award for basketball... Playmaker Award for soccer... As a freshman; Coaches Award for basketball and soccer...

Parents: Tim and Neda McDonald.
